6. FTC and Disclosure Requirements
You must comply with all applicable laws regarding disclosure of material connections. This includes, but is not limited to, the U.S. Federal Trade Commission (FTC) guidelines.
6.1 Required Disclosures
Every piece of content that promotes Scripts Viral or contains your affiliate link must include a clear and conspicuous disclosure that you may earn a commission. Examples of acceptable disclosures include:
- "This post contains affiliate links. I may earn a commission if you sign up."
- "#ad #affiliate" in social media posts
- "Sponsored" or "Paid partnership" labels where available
- Verbal disclosure in video content before promoting
6.2 Disclosure Placement
Disclosures must be:
- Clear and prominent, not hidden in fine print
- Close to the affiliate link or promotional claim
- In the same language as the promotional content
- Visible before the user would click on an affiliate link
- Present in both the video and description for video content
